Overview

Postcode LL73 8PB is located in a remote rural village, within the Lligwy ward of Isle of Anglesey in the Wales region, and forms part of the Rhos-y-bol, Marian-glas & Moelfre area. It has low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 15.6 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 82% below the Wales average of 86 per 1,000. The average income per household in Rhos-y-bol, Marian-glas & Moelfre is £47,425 per year. The nearest station is Llanfairpwll, about 8.1 miles away. There are no primary and no secondary schools in the area.

Property prices in Lligwy

Median price£262,500
Price per sq ft£284
Sales (last 12 months)78
Typical range (middle 50%)£215K – £381K

Based on 78 recent sales, the median property price is £262,500 (about £284 per square foot) in Lligwy area, with individual transactions ranging from £110,000 up to £940,000.
